Join our guide Glenn Cook, from the Wildflower Society of Western Australia (Perth Branch), for an afternoon stroll through nearby Baigup Wetlands. Explore the variety of seeds currently to be found in this vibrant patch of remnant wetland. Just a short walk from the current SEEDS exhibition at Ellis House Art Centre, 116 Milne St, Bayswater Western Australia 6053. The walk will depart from Ellis House Community Art Centre at 4.00pm.
Free event but please register - get tickets - via the link below.
Glenn will be able to identify the myriad of local flora, both naturally occurring and species reintroduced into degraded areas of the reserve as part of rehabilitation efforts. This walk will focus on what seeds can currently be seen in Baigup Wetlands. (Glenn coordinates the nearby Friends of EricSingleton Wetland group.
Rosemary Lynch the current coordinator of the Baigup Wetlands Interest Group will also be on hand to answer any questions that arise about the group's activities.
About the SEEDS Exhibtion at Ellis House Art Centre
Prior to the walk be sure to arrive at Ellis House Art Centre at the very least a half hour earlier to enjoy looking at the exquisite SEEDS Exhibition. Arrive by 3.30pm at the latest, come earlier if possible so that you can view the works of six artists exploring the central theme of the "Seed" from their own perspective in a variety of mediums from acrylic and oil painting to textiles and painted seed pods. In a lively and fascinating display of paintings, ecoprints, textile creations, prints and sculpture – as well as specimens of actual seeds and pods to examine – the exhibition explores myriad aspects of the theme: seeds and germination. Featuring works by Jo Haythornthwaite, Michelle Ella, Stephanie Sheppard, Celeste Lopez, Madeline Vincenzi, and Marie Mitchell.
